My flattened plisse was/wasn't deliberate. A scarfie detailed the entire deplissing process in another thread and I happened to come across a rather cheap (H-cheap) Astrologie, so I bought it with the vague intention of washing and deplissing as an experiment. As with all plans by mice and men, RL got in the way. I put the limp plisse into the "for laundering" pile and never got round to dealing with it as it was low priority. Then, during my six-monthly update of the scarf Excel (the location column forever gets out of date), I unearthed it and the weight of the orange boxes on it had quite flattened it (like pressed flowers!).

Would I deliberately deplisse again? Nope. The pleats have left a striped appearance on the fabric and there is obvious wear on the folds. Deplissing is tempting because the same design is often cheaper in plisse, but I'd buy a plisse for its own charms.

If you don't look closely, the scarf is fine. (And black, so I'm on theme!)
